  • Title

    Convergence of the Modified Gauss-Seidel Method for H-matrices

  • Abstract
    In this paper, we present a new preconditioner which is different from the preconditioner given by Milaszewicz, and prove the monotone convergence theory about this method when the coefficient matrix is an H - matrices. This directly leads to several novel sufficient conditions for guaranteeing the convergence of the preconditioned iterative method.
